Tomlin has been a major force in American comedy since the late 1960s when she began a career as a standup comedian. Her career has spanned television, comedy recordings, Broadway, and motion pictures, enjoying acclaimed success in each medium. She has starred in such films as Nashville, Nine to Five, All of Me, The Beverly Hillbillies, and I Heart Huckabees. Her notable television roles include Rowan and Martin's Laugh-In as a cast member from 1970-73, Ms. Frizzle on The Magic School Bus, Kay Carter-Shepley on Murphy Brown, and Deborah Fiderer on The West Wing.
Tomlin's long list of awards includes a Grammy, two Tonys, six Emmys, an Oscar nomination, two Peabodys, and the prestigious Mark Twain Prize for American Humor.
